Abstract
The changes in the characteristics of microstrip rejection filter and simple microstriplines due to bulk and thin film dielectric overlay are reported in this paper. Al2O3 overlay both bulk and thin film increases theQ of the filter. All other overlays decrease theQ. TiO2 thin film shows improvement inQ whereas with bulk TiO2 the filtering property is not observed. The effect of overlays on simple lines is to reduce the transmission without much effect in the reflection.
